|
|
@ -1368,8 +1368,10 @@ sub checksystem{
|
|
|
|
if($data{vendor}=~m/^\s+$/ || $data{vendor}=~m/Chassis Manufacture/){
|
|
|
|
if($data{vendor}=~m/^\s+$/ || $data{vendor}=~m/Chassis Manufacture/){
|
|
|
|
$data{vendor} = 'Chassis Manufacture';
|
|
|
|
$data{vendor} = 'Chassis Manufacture';
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
if(
|
|
|
|
if(-e "/sys/class/dmi/id/board_name" && `cat /sys/class/dmi/id/board_name | grep "Portable PC"`){
|
|
|
|
(-e "/sys/class/dmi/id/board_name" && `cat /sys/class/dmi/id/board_name | grep "Portable PC"`) ||
|
|
|
|
|
|
|
|
(-e "/sys/class/dmi/id/chassis_type" && `cat /sys/class/dmi/id/chassis_type | grep "10"`)
|
|
|
|
|
|
|
|
){
|
|
|
|
$data{laptop} = lc($data{vendor});
|
|
|
|
$data{laptop} = lc($data{vendor});
|
|
|
|
$data{laptop_model} = `cat /sys/class/dmi/id/product_name`;
|
|
|
|
$data{laptop_model} = `cat /sys/class/dmi/id/product_name`;
|
|
|
|
chomp ($data{laptop_model});
|
|
|
|
chomp ($data{laptop_model});
|
|
|
|